Meicha is made by the tender stems and leaves of A.megalophylla Diels et.Gilg.It is used to treat hypertension in clinic and has a remarkable efficacy. The main effective chemical constituents are total flavonoids,which are proved by pharmacology experiments that can reduce high blood pressure,high blood lipid,glycemia and can protect liver,improve immunity.Furthermore,its adverse effect is low.So it can be produced as a new effective drug of treating Cardiov-ascular diseases.On the chemical constitution study of Meicha and preparing Meicha total flavonoid extracts study,we study quality control of Meicha total flavonoid extracts,which establish certain base for the new drug study of Meicha.First,we collect some correlative data and literature of Meicha to Determine Meicha's effective chemical ingredients,pharmacology effect and chemical quality,which direct the way of how to study on quality control of Meicha total flavonoid extracts.The quality and character of Meicha total flavonoid extracts are examined;Ampelopsin and Myricetin of Meicha total flavonoid extracts are identified by silica gel thin-layer chromatography and polyamide thin-layer chromatography;The contents of the total flavonoids,Ampelopsin and Myricetin of Meicha total flavonoid extracts are measured;study on HPLC fingerprint of Meicha total flavonoid extracts;the contents of residual organic solvents in Meicha total flavonoid extracts are measured.Result:Meicha total flavonoid extracts are yellow amorphous powder;Meicha total flavonoid extracts are slightly soluble in pH1 hydrochloric acid solutions,Ph6.8 phosphate buffer and distilled water,and are easily soluble in ethanol;the angle of repose of Meicha total flavonoid extracts is 35.7±0.40°;the CRH of Meicha total flavonoid extracts is about 82%;the density of Meicha total flavonoid extracts is 0.68 mg·mL-3;the contents of water of Meicha total flavonoid extracts conform to the requirement;identifying Ampelopsin and Myricetin with silica gel thin-layer chromatography and polyamide thin-layer chromatography are separately established; the contents of the total flavonoids,Ampelopsi and Myricetin are measured, and are not lower than 78%,44%,11%respectively.HPLC fingerprint of Meicha total flavonoid extracts is established by study on 10 batches of Meicha total flavonoid extracts,showing 10 common peaks and similarity>0.9,peak 3,9 and 11 as Ampelopsin,Myricetin and Quercetin;the residue of Divinylbenzene is less than 0.002%,and Benzene,Toluene,Xylene,Styrene and n-Hexane are not respectively detected in Meicha total flavonoid extracts.Research methods of quality control of Meicha total flavonoid extracts are set up through the study of the subject.
